I agree with this, but will share one thing that has served me very well in dealing with the most difficult thing in church-- people.
In one of the translations of Isaiah 53, referring to Christ going to the cross, it says; "He took our offences".
If this is the case (and I believe it is) then what right do any of us being offended by another. It is described as taking offence.
What if we all decided that none of us was ever going to take offence ever again? We really don't have the right to.

I learn all kinds of things from the word. I learn how to deal with hard times, i learn to see things through God eyes instead of the world, how to be in it but not of it, how to withstand persecution and trials, how to demonstrate love, how to love my enemies.

Most importantly, i talk to God when i'm reading, i'm asking Him questions, i'm learning about His character and His love for us. I get to know Him more and more through His word.

One of the killions of things i love about Jesus is how he could be walking down a road with people cheering Him on and celebrating, but see a tax collector in a tree or recognise a need that everyone else seems to step over. He recognises and has compassion and heals and loves.

I love how He was unphased by others opinions of Him, or the intentions of the Pharisees to trap Him all the time. All He did was speak the truth, and not everyone liked it because it was challenging at times. But the truth sets us free. Praise God for the truth!!

I love how He hated hypocrisy and pride, and He always looked at the hearts. If they were repentant or willing to try, wherever they were at, however much sin they had in their lives, if they were willing, He knew their ears and eyes were open to the truth of God.

I love how He simplified things and tried to bring people back into relationship with God.
